Name the two components of Wise Mind and explain what they are.

Reasonable mind + Emotion Mind (overlapping) =
Facts and Logic + Mood and Feelings

500

Name Three "What" skills and describe them

Observe - Notice body sensations, pay attention to in and outside self
Describe - Name/label experiences and observations

Participate - go with flow and get into activity
